    AnnotationThe causes of geomagnetic disturbances are either high velocity streams of solar wind originating in coronal holes or coronal mass ejections related to solar energetic events. In this presentation we will concentrate on the second case. Data concerning solar energetic events, published by the USAF/NOAA in the form of daily reports, have been collected since 1996. An analysis of ten years long data collection has shown that the degree of the geoeffectiveness of energetic events depends not only on their size and on their solar disc location but also on the fact whether the events are associated with type II and IV radio bursts.
